WEC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review
1,130 of the 6,964 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in WEC Energy (WEC)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$24.2B — up 26% from $19.3B a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 149 funds opened new WEC positions and 86 closed out — a net gain of 63 holders — while 433 added to existing stakes and 341 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Wellington Management Group, adding an estimated $416M. The largest seller was Qube Research & Technologies (QRT), cutting an estimated $91.3M.
